OTOEOHANGA COUNTY.
MEETING OF THE COUNCIL. fPir TELEGRAPH. —OWN CORRESPONDENT.] 'OTOROHANCA, Friday The Otorohanga County Council met tin?, week, Mr. F. Potts presiding. Tim Postal Department notified that it was unable to agree to tho release of the council from the terms of tho bond in connection with the Ngaroraa telephone. It was decided to pay the amount due, £16 14s 3d, and to ascertain whether this was. finality. The Minister for Public Works wrote stating that he had agreed to a grant of £75 for repair work on the OkupataPokanui Road. T?.io Chamber of Commerce urged application to tho Forestry Department for treeu to plant on county reserves, but tho council, while sympathising with the suggestion, decided to reply that it had no funds available. Permission was given tho Otorohanga Gravel and Concrete Manufacturing Co., Ltd., to excavate shingle from Uio banks of tho Yvaipa River within tho area owned by tho company, subject to tho county's rights being safeguarded. In response to a request from Mangaorougo settlers it was decided to invito the district engineer to visit that district and inspect a bridge site which the settlers believed would be preferable to making a new road and closing an old one. Tenders for metalling were accepted as follows: —80 chains of Lunman's Road, S. J. Rankin, £257 6s 6d; Maihiihi to Brock's Road, J. C. Petersen, £1686 12s. a distance of 2 3 miles; Ngahapo Road, P. Anderson, ,E531 10s. . The county engineer reported that pro posals would sho'tlv be forwarded to the Mdir, Highways Board for the expenditure of £300 for metalling a portion of tie KawhiaKawa Road near To lamoa The metalling of 2[, miles of thi Poowhenua Road would be taken in »jand as soon as the Public Works Dennrtiri'iit ap proved and funds were available, Tender? would shortly be called for metalling 123 chains of Barber's Road.
